The Malt Shovel

Newton Road

pub maltshovel (19K)

 The current building was built around 1935. It replaced an inn of the same name.In 1961 the pub was serving Darbys ale. Originally it had its own brewery.

Malt Shovel and Brewhouse

Landlords

  • Dennis and Flo Ward 1982-? [previously at the Red Admiral]
  • Henry Whitehouse was the landlord c.1935-1950
  • Thomas Newey, Licensed Victuallerand Maltser, 1881
  • Samuel Smith Bailey 1912 (Kellys diretory)
